在如今的数字化时代,企业面临的数据量呈指数级增长,如何有效地分析和利用这些数据成为了企业竞争力的关键。智能BI系统的部署不仅仅是一个技术问题,更是一个战略性决策。开源工具的使用为这一过程提供了灵活性和可扩展性,但也带来了一些挑战。本文将详细探讨如何部署智能BI系统,并重点介绍开源工具的使用流程,帮助企业在数据分析的道路上行稳致远。

🚀智能BI系统部署的准备阶段
在部署智能BI系统之前,准备阶段是至关重要的,它将决定整个项目的成功与否。企业需要明确数据分析的目标,评估现有的数据基础设施,并选择合适的工具和技术路线。
1️⃣明确数据分析目标
首先,企业需要清晰地定义数据分析的目标。这可能包括提高销售业绩、优化运营效率、提升客户满意度等。明确的目标将指导后续的技术选择和实施方案。
- 目标导向:通过设定具体的KPI(关键绩效指标),企业能够更好地衡量BI系统的有效性。
- 资源评估:在目标明确后,企业需要评估现有的数据资源,以确保BI系统能有效利用这些数据。
- 需求调研:与企业内部的各个部门沟通,了解他们的数据分析需求和痛点,以便后续BI系统的功能设计。
2️⃣评估现有数据基础设施
评估现有的数据基础设施是准备阶段的重要步骤。企业需要明确当前的数据存储、处理能力,以及数据质量问题。
- 数据存储:了解企业现有的数据存储方案,包括数据库类型、数据量以及数据增长速度。
- 数据处理:评估当前的数据处理能力,是否能够支持实时的数据分析需求。
- 数据质量:检查数据的完整性、准确性和一致性,确保数据分析的可靠性。
以下是常见的数据基础设施评估指标:
指标 | 评估内容 | 重要性 |
---|---|---|
数据库类型 | SQL、NoSQL | 高 |
数据量 | TB、PB级别 | 高 |
数据处理速度 | 秒级、分钟级 | 中 |
数据质量 | 完整性、准确性 | 高 |
3️⃣选择合适的开源工具
选择合适的开源工具是智能BI系统部署的关键一步。开源工具不仅节约成本,还提供了灵活的定制能力。
- 成本节约:开源工具通常不需要昂贵的许可费用,但实施和维护成本需考虑。
- 灵活性:开源工具的代码可定制,使其能够适应企业的特殊需求。
- 社区支持:强大的社区支持意味着更快的bug修复和功能更新。
在选择开源工具时,企业可以考虑以下几个方面:
开源工具 | 功能 | 社区支持 |
---|---|---|
Apache Superset | 数据可视化 | 高 |
Metabase | 自助分析 | 中 |
Redash | 报表生成 | 高 |
选择开源工具后,企业应进行试用和评估,以确保其能够满足实际需求。
🔧智能BI系统的实施步骤
在准备阶段完成后,接下来就是智能BI系统的实施步骤。这一阶段涉及到系统的安装、配置、数据集成以及用户培训。
1️⃣系统安装与配置
系统的安装与配置是BI系统实施的基础。企业需要根据需求选择合适的服务器环境,并进行软件的安装和配置。
- 服务器选择:根据数据量和分析需求,选择合适的服务器规格。
- 软件安装:下载开源工具的最新版本,并进行安装。
- 系统配置:根据企业的需求,进行系统的初始配置,包括用户权限、数据连接等。
以下是系统安装与配置的关键步骤:
步骤 | 内容 | 工具 |
---|---|---|
服务器选择 | 评估需求 | AWS、Azure |
软件安装 | 下载与安装 | GitHub |
系统配置 | 用户权限设置 | Admin UI |
2️⃣数据集成与清洗
数据集成与清洗是保证BI系统数据质量的重要步骤。企业需要将分散的数据进行统一整合,并进行必要的清洗操作。
- 数据集成:使用ETL工具将不同来源的数据进行整合,确保数据的一致性。
- 数据清洗:去除重复和错误数据,填补数据缺失,提高数据质量。
- 数据建模:根据分析需求,进行数据建模,以支持后续的分析和可视化。
在数据集成与清洗过程中,企业可以使用以下工具和方法:
工具 | 功能 | 优势 |
---|---|---|
Talend | ETL | 高效 |
OpenRefine | 数据清洗 | 简便 |
FineBI | 数据建模 | 强大 |
推荐使用 FineBI在线试用 来进行数据建模,其连续八年中国市场占有率第一,值得信赖。
3️⃣用户培训与支持
用户培训与支持是确保BI系统成功应用的关键。企业需要提供系统的培训,帮助用户熟练掌握BI工具的使用。
- 培训计划:制定详细的培训计划,涵盖系统操作、数据分析技巧等。
- 用户手册:编写用户手册和操作指南,帮助用户快速上手。
- 支持服务:提供持续的技术支持和问题解决服务,确保系统的稳定运行。
以下是用户培训与支持的常见方法:
方法 | 内容 | 实施 |
---|---|---|
培训计划 | 系统操作 | 讲座 |
用户手册 | 操作指南 | 文档 |
支持服务 | 技术支持 | 在线 |
📈智能BI系统的优化与维护
智能BI系统的优化与维护是一个持续的过程,旨在确保系统能够长期稳定运行,并满足不断变化的业务需求。
1️⃣系统性能优化
优化系统性能是提高数据分析效率的关键。企业需要定期检查系统性能,并进行必要的优化。
- 性能监测:使用监测工具定期检查系统性能,识别瓶颈。
- 硬件升级:根据需求进行硬件升级,提高系统处理能力。
- 软件优化:定期更新软件版本,优化代码,提高执行效率。
以下是系统性能优化的常见措施:
措施 | 内容 | 效果 |
---|---|---|
性能监测 | 系统检查 | 实时 |
硬件升级 | 资源扩展 | 高效 |
软件优化 | 版本更新 | 稳定 |
2️⃣数据质量维护
数据质量是BI系统分析结果可靠性的基础,企业需要制定数据质量维护计划。
- 数据审核:定期审核数据质量,识别和解决质量问题。
- 数据更新:确保数据的及时更新,保持数据的准确性。
- 数据安全:实施数据安全措施,保护数据的完整性和机密性。
以下是数据质量维护的关键步骤:
步骤 | 内容 | 工具 |
---|---|---|
数据审核 | 质量检查 | Audit Tool |
数据更新 | 定期刷新 | Scheduler |
数据安全 | 保护措施 | Security System |
3️⃣用户反馈与改进
用户反馈是系统优化的重要依据。企业应建立用户反馈机制,并根据反馈进行系统改进。
- 反馈机制:建立用户反馈渠道,收集用户意见和建议。
- 问题解决:根据用户反馈,及时解决系统问题,提高用户满意度。
- 功能改进:根据用户需求,不断改进和完善系统功能。
以下是用户反馈与改进的常见方法:
方法 | 内容 | 实施 |
---|---|---|
反馈机制 | 意见收集 | Polls |
问题解决 | 快速响应 | Helpdesk |
功能改进 | 系统更新 | Development |
📚总结与展望
智能BI系统的部署是一个复杂而又重要的过程,它不仅涉及技术实现,也需要战略规划和持续优化。通过选择合适的开源工具,企业能够以较低的成本获得强大的数据分析能力。在实施过程中,明确数据分析目标,评估基础设施,配置系统,集成数据,培训用户以及优化和维护都是至关重要的步骤。持续的用户反馈和数据质量维护将确保系统的长期成功应用。未来,随着数据量的进一步增加和技术的不断进步,智能BI系统将成为企业决策的重要支撑。
权威来源:

- 《数据分析实战:从理论到实践》,张三,电子工业出版社,2020。
- 《开源工具与数据处理技术》,李四,机械工业出版社,2019。
- 《商业智能与数据仓库》,王五,人民邮电出版社,2018。
通过本文的探讨,希望企业能够在智能BI系统的部署过程中获得实用的指导,提升数据分析能力,为业务决策提供强有力的支持。
本文相关FAQs
🤔 如何选择适合企业的智能BI系统?
老板最近在开会时提到要引入智能BI系统,但市场上的BI工具琳琅满目,像Tableau、Power BI、FineBI等,我们该如何选择适合自己企业的BI系统呢?有没有哪位大佬能分享一些实际的经验和建议,具体要考虑哪些因素?
选择合适的BI系统对于企业数字化转型至关重要。首先,你需要明确企业的业务需求和分析目标。不同的BI系统在功能特性、用户体验和技术支持上各有千秋。例如,FineBI以自助分析见长,非常适合需要快速响应业务变化的企业。你可以通过以下几个方面进行选择:
- 易用性:BI系统的用户界面和操作流程是否简单易懂,能否支持业务人员轻松上手。
- 数据集成能力:系统是否支持与企业现有的数据源无缝对接,如ERP、CRM等,是否支持多种数据格式。
- 扩展性和灵活性:系统是否可以根据企业发展的不同阶段进行功能扩展,是否支持自定义分析模块。
- 成本:考虑到企业预算,评估系统的购买、实施和维护成本。
- 社区和支持:选择一个有活跃用户社区和技术支持的工具,能在遇到问题时及时获得帮助。
对比选择后,可以先进行小规模试用,看看哪款工具更符合企业的实际需求和使用习惯。对于想要试用FineBI的企业,可以点击这里进行 FineBI在线试用 。
🚀 开源BI工具部署流程是什么?
小公司预算有限,想要尝试一些开源的BI工具,比如Metabase或Apache Superset,怎么能快速进行部署呢?有没有详细的流程步骤或者注意事项可以参考一下?
部署开源BI工具可以为中小企业提供性价比高的数据分析解决方案。以下是一个通用的部署流程供参考:
- 选择合适的工具:根据企业需求选择合适的开源BI工具,如Metabase、Apache Superset等。
- 准备服务器环境:确保服务器满足BI工具的系统要求,一般需要Linux服务器、较新的Java版本和充分的内存。
- 安装依赖:如Java、Python等,根据工具的要求安装必要的软件和库。
- 下载和配置BI工具:从官方仓库下载最新版本的BI工具,解压和配置环境变量。
- 连接数据源:配置BI工具与企业数据库的连接,确保数据源的可访问性和权限配置。
- 测试和优化:测试BI工具的各项功能是否正常工作,调整性能参数以满足企业的使用需求。
需要注意的是,部署过程中要特别关注数据安全和权限管理,保证只有授权用户才能访问敏感数据。同时,尽可能地参与开源社区活动,借助社区资源解决问题。
🔄 如何优化BI系统的使用效率?
我们公司已经部署了BI系统,但感觉使用效率不高,分析报告生成速度慢,用户反馈体验不好。有没有什么办法可以优化BI系统的使用效率?
优化BI系统的使用效率是提升企业数据分析能力的关键。首先需要明确当前系统的瓶颈所在,通过分析可以发现常见问题如:数据源读取速度慢、复杂查询耗时过长、系统资源配置不足等。以下是一些具体的优化建议:
- 数据建模优化:优化数据模型结构,减少冗余数据和复杂联表操作,使用分区、索引等技术提升查询速度。
- 硬件资源升级:评估服务器的CPU、内存和存储资源,必要时进行升级以满足高并发和大数据量的处理需求。
- 缓存机制:利用BI系统的缓存功能,减少重复查询对数据库的压力,加快常用报告的生成速度。
- 用户权限管理:合理配置用户权限,减少不必要的数据访问和操作,提升系统整体性能。
- 培训和使用规范:对用户进行系统使用培训,制定统一的使用规范和最佳实践,避免因误操作导致的性能问题。
定期对系统进行性能监控和评估,找出新的优化机会,并结合实际业务发展调整系统配置。通过这些方法,可以有效提升BI系统的响应速度和用户体验。
